The Cajon housing market is very competitive. The median sale price of a home in Cajon was $505K last month, up .0%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in Cajon is $374, up 21.6% since last year.
In February 2025, Cajon home prices were up .0%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$505K. On average, homes in Cajon sell after 51 days on the market compared to 18 days last year. There were 6 homes sold in February this year, up from 6 last year.

Flood Factor - Minor
50% of properties are at risk of severe flooding over the next 30 years
Flood Factor
Cajon has a minor risk of flooding. 250 properties in Cajon are likely to be
severely affected
by flooding over the next 30 years. This represents 50% of all properties in Cajon. Flood risk is increasing slower than the national average.
100% of properties are at risk of wildfire over the next 30 years
Fire Factor
Cajon has a severe risk of wildfire. There are 1,154 properties in Cajon that have some risk of being affected by wildfire over the next 30 years. This represents 100% of all properties in Cajon.
